Title: Tamper Zone 0
Post by: denshiff on October 28, 2018, 05:26:38 PM
I just updated my security system from DS10A to DS12A window and door sensors. Now soon after I arm my console (Model SCV1200) the alarm sounds and I get the code "Tamper Zone 0".  I have zones 1 - 10 armed... there is no 0. Could someone please help.

Is Zone 0 an option? Mine is not the latest but the Zones are 1-30 for wireless devices and 31-32 for the hard wired Zones.
If Zone 0 is an option and you have no sensor on 0. Have you tried the remove a sensor choice in the menu. To remove anything in Zone 0.

The DS12A has two individual zones in it. The magnetic switch next to the side of the case and an external wired in magnetic switch connected to the terminal block on the bottom edge of the PCB. If the external zone is not used. You need a jumper between the two terminals. Should be there from the factory but I would verify it is there. I actually used only the external switch input. As my DS12A would not mount so the supplied magnet would not line up with the case and was unused. So I only registered the external one. I have tested and you can actually register each as a separate zone in the SC1200.
